Oguchi Onyewu's comeback season with Sporting Lisbon has encountered a massive setback.
Onyewu suffered a torn ligament and meniscus in his right knee and requires surgery that will
keep him out of action for two months, according to Sporting Lisbon's official website.
Onyewu suffered the injury in Sporting's victory over Pacos de Ferreira over the weekend,
needing to be substituted off after 27 minutes.

Schalke 04 midfielder Jermaine Jones won't be available for the United States due to a right calf
injury, the US Soccer Federation announced on Wednesday. Jones played in the January friendlies for
the USA. Jones's absence reduces the US roster to 20 players available for Wednesday's game against
Italy (2:30pm ET - ESPN2).
Seattle Sounders coach Sigi Schmid ruled out Eddie Johnson for Wednesday's Community Shield
match against Jaguares. Johnson has been nursing a hamstring injury ever since he came out early
from his preseason debut on Feb. 22. On Monday, he did not fully participate in practice and
trained off to the side.
